Changes to Permitted Development Regulations - Graham Stallwood, the Borough's Development Control Manager will be present at the Conference to explain changes in the legislation in relation to what residents can do without planning permission.There will be an opportunity for discussion and questions
Natural Environment and Rural Communities Act - Kate Dagnall, the Borough's Environment Officer, will be present at the Conference to address the meeting in relation to the Natural Environment and Rural Communities Act, which places certain duties on Parish Councils in relation to consideration of biodiversity initiatives.There will be an opportunity for discussion and questions
Road Resurfacing - Stephen Brown, the Borough's Head of Highways & Engineering, will be present at the Conference to address the meeting in relation to road resurfacing in the Borough, and communications relating to road surveys and resurfacing with relevant Parish Councils.There will be an opportunity for discussion and questions.
Distraction Burglary - Brian Martin, the Royal Borough's Community Safety Co-ordinator, will be present at the Conference to address the meeting in relation to the Crime and Disorder Partnership's work regarding distraction burglaries and how Parish Councils can be involved.There will be an opportunity for discussion and questions.
Parish Walks - The Chairman of the Parish Conference, Councillor Mrs Bateson will address the Conference in relation to Parish Walks.
Presentation at Next Conference - The Conference will no doubt recall that, at the Conference meeting in June 2008, it was agreed that Bray Parish Council be invited to present at the next Conference on its success with the Fifield and Oakley Green Community Plan. Bray Parish Council have requested that the item be deferred until the next meeting of the Conference in February 2009, to enable the results of a residents' survey, currently underway, to be included in their presentation.The Conference is therefore requested to note the deferral of this item.
